Using your 2019 R1 SDK and a Nvidia P620 graphics card, we see from the Level 3 diagnostics windows that only one video stream uses Nvidia acceleration at a time. All the others fall back to Intel (HD530 integral to CPU). All cameras are using H.264 and use Nvidia acceleration when viewed individually. Showing the same camera in two views results in Nvidia acceleration in one and Intel in the other. Is this an SDK issue, an Nvidia issue, or something else. We’d like all our camera views to use Nvidia hardware acceleration.
I will try to reproduce..
For me this works perfectly.
Note that the way it works is load balancing the graphics options. So in my test I saw two ImageViewerControls use NVIDIA, the next two ImageViewerControls use Intel, the next use NVIDIA and so on..
If you observe that you open 10 ImageViewerControls (or however many you can without depleting the RAM on the application) and never more than one is using NVIDIA it might be suspicious. Let me know in more detail what you observe..
PS. For so many issue regarding hardware acceleration we see the issue resolve by simply making sure the latest applicable driver is used for the graphics, if you have not already done so, please check this.
